site stats

Rdd is fault-tolerant and immutable

WebDaily Spark Day 5 💥Resilient Distributed Dataset (RDD)💥 📌The Resilient Distributed Dataset is basic data structure used to hold data for processing… WebContribute to sagardhavalgi/PySpark development by creating an account on GitHub.

What is RDD? Comprehensive Guide to RDD with Advantages

WebDec 12, 2024 · Fault Tolerance - If we lose any RDD while working on any node, the RDD will automatically recover. Different transformations that we apply to RDDs result in a logical execution strategy. The term "lineage graph" often refers to the logical execution plan. ... An RDD is immutable and unchangeable contents guarantee data stability. Tolerance for ... WebFeb 18, 2024 · RDD uses MapReduce operations which is widely adopted for processing and generating large datasets with a parallel, distributed algorithm on a cluster. It allows users to write parallel computations, using a set of high-level operators, without having to worry about work distribution and fault tolerance. of_phy_connect failed https://kaiserconsultants.net

RDD Fundamentals – Vidvaan – Java Tutorial

WebIt is an immutable and fault-tolerant distributed collection of elements that are well partitioned and different operations can be performed on them to form other RDDs. … WebFault tolerance requires replication -- expensive for data intensive tasks ... RDD Abstraction RDD is a read-only, partitioned collection of records: Read-only: RDDs are immutable once generated Partitioned: An RDD consists of multiple partitions ... (RDD) Efficient, general-purpose, fault-tolerant data abstraction WebNov 15, 2015 · This is the problem that RDD intends to solve — by providing a general purpose, fault tolerant, distributed memory abstraction. ... RDD Overview. RDDs are immutable partitioned collections that ... of philosopher\\u0027s

PySpark RDD: Everything You Need to Know Simplilearn

Category:The Ultimate Guide to Functional Programming for Big Data

Tags:Rdd is fault-tolerant and immutable

Rdd is fault-tolerant and immutable

RDD Fundamentals – Vidvaan – Java Tutorial

WebDec 12, 2024 · Fault Tolerance - If we lose any RDD while working on any node, the RDD will automatically recover. Different transformations that we apply to RDDs result in a logical … WebMay 31, 2024 · Because the Apache Spark RDD is immutable, each Spark RDD retains the lineage of the deterministic operation that was used to create it on a fault-tolerant input dataset. If any partition of an RDD is lost due to a worker node failure, that partition can be re-computed using the lineage of operations from the original fault-tolerant dataset.

Rdd is fault-tolerant and immutable

Did you know?

WebFault Tolerance in RDD is achieved using For Multiclass classification problem which algorithm is not the solution? Given a DataFrame df that has some null values in the column created_date, find the code below such that it will sort rows in ascending order based on the column creted_date with null values appearing last. WebRDD (Resilient Distributed Dataset) is the fundamental data structure of Apache Spark which are an immutable collection of objects which computes on the different node of the …

WebApr 6, 2024 · Fault Tolerance: RDDs allow Spark to manage situations of node failure and safeguard your cluster from data loss. Moreover, it regularly stores the transformations … WebApr 13, 2024 · Apache Spark RDD: an effective evolution of Hadoop MapReduce. Hadoop MapReduce badly needed an overhaul. and Apache Spark RDD has stepped up to the plate. Spark RDD uses in-memory processing, immutability, parallelism, fault tolerance, and more to surpass its predecessor. It’s a fast, flexible, and versatile framework for data processing.

Webdata items. This allows them to efficiently provide fault tolerance by logging the transformations used to build a dataset (its lineage) rather than the actual data.1 If a parti-tion of an RDD is lost, the RDD has enough information about how it was derived from other RDDs to recompute 1Checkpointing the data in some RDDs may be useful when a lin- WebFeb 17, 2024 · RDD uses MapReduce operations which is widely adopted for processing and generating large datasets with a parallel, distributed algorithm on a cluster. It allows users …

Web7. Fault Tolerance. While working on any node, if we lost any RDD itself recovers itself. When we apply different transformations on RDDs, it creates a logical execution plan. The logical execution plan is generally known as lineage graph. As a consequence, we may lose RDD as if any fault arises in the machine.

WebApr 6, 2024 · The RDD is the key data structure available in Spark and consists of distributed collections of multiple objects. The popularity of this Resilient Distributed Dataset comes from its fault-tolerant nature, which allows them to … my foggy brainWebOct 9, 2024 · Resilient Distributed Dataset (RDD) Terminology RDD stands for Resilient Distributed Dataset, an entity that is started and runs on multiple nodes to perform cluster … of philosophy\\u0027sWebAug 30, 2024 · This is because RDDs are immutable. This feature makes RDDs fault-tolerant and the lost data can also be recovered easily. When to use RDDs? RDD is preferred to use … of-phraseWebJul 21, 2024 · The contents of an RDD are immutable and cannot be modified, providing data stability. Fault tolerance. RDDs are resilient and can recompute missing or damaged … ofpihiWebNov 10, 2016 · This is a powerful property: in essence, makes RDD fault-tolerant (Resilient). If a partition of an RDD is lost, the RDD has enough information about how it was derived from other RDDs to ... of philosophy\u0027sWebAn RDD is an immutable, deterministically re-computable, distributed dataset. Each RDD remembers the lineage of deterministic operations that were used on a fault-tolerant input dataset to create it. ... If all of the input data is already present in a fault-tolerant file system like HDFS, Spark Streaming can always recover from any failure and ... ofp i cant join serverWebfault-tolerant manner. RDDs are motivated by two types of applications that current computing frameworks han-dle inefficiently: iterative algorithms and interactive data … my foam mattress is too firm